William Oliver Stone (born September 15, 1946) is an American filmmaker. Stone is known as a controversial but acclaimed director, tackling subjects ranging from the Vietnam War, and American politics to musical biopics and crime dramas. He has received numerous accolades including three Academy Awards, a BAFTA Award, a Primetime Emmy Award, and five Golden Globe Awards. Stone was born in New York City and later briefly attended Yale University. In 1967, Stone enlisted in the United States Army during the Vietnam War. He then served from 1967 to 1968 in the 25th Infantry Division and was twice wounded in action. For his service, he received military honors such as the Bronze Star with "V" Device for valor, the Purple Heart with Oak Leaf Cluster, the National Defense Service Medal, the Vietnam Service Medal with one Silver Service Star. His service in Vietnam would be the basis for his later career as a filmmaker in depicting the brutality of war. Hardcover. Zustand: Near Fine. Limited Edition. A beautiful set of original wood engravings illustrating the poems of Warner. This was designed by Ruari McLean and printed by Longmans at Dorchester England. A special production to launch a new typeface, issued in 500 unnumbered copies. The typeface was Dante Roman, and is here used for the first time. The previous issue was officially pulped because of production problems, but the gorgeous wood engravings are entirely satisfactory in this issue. An essential for collectors of Reynolds Stone.
